We recently coupled nanoparticle-based sensors on an 8-biosensor array with off-line protein capture into a simple microfluidic system (Fig. 1.12) [112]. This microfluidic immunoassay system features AuNP sensor electrodes built on a screen-printed carbon platform inserted into a molded 70 pL PDMS channel... [Pg.17]

Abstract. Surface-eDhanced Raman scattering is a powerful tool for the investigation of biological samples. Following a brief introduction to Raman and surface-enhanced Raman scattering, several examples of biophotonic applications of SERS are discussed. The concept of nanoparticle-based sensors using SERS is introduced and the development of these sensors is discussed. [Pg.182]

The ability to incorporate nanoparticles into living cells and make localized measurements of chemical concentrations has inspired our group to develop nanoparticle-based sensors. The following sections detail the development of nanoparticle-based sensors using SERS. [Pg.186]
